Leea guineensis

What's the taxonomical classification of Leea guineensis?

Leea guineensis belongs to the kingdom Plantae and is classified under the phylum Streptophyta. Within the class Equisetopsida, it is further categorized into the subclass Magnoliidae. The plant follows the order Vitales and is a member of the family Vitaceae. Taxonomically, it is placed within the genus Leea, with its specific identification being the species guineensis.

What is the geographical distribution of this plant?

This plant is native to the tropical rainforest regions of West and Central Africa, specifically spanning from Guinea through Nigeria to the Congo Basin. It thrives primarily in humid, low-altitude environments where heavy rainfall is consistent throughout the year. The species is frequently found in the understory of dense forest canopies where shade and moisture are abundant. Its range is closely tied to the Guineo-Congolian phytogeographical region. Localized populations are often concentrated near riverbanks and damp forest edges.

According to a study published by "Heliyon", the Leea genus contains approximately 70 species. Within this genus, Leea guineensis is identified as a species that contains reported phytochemicals. These organic compounds include flavonoids, glycosides, phenols, terpenoids, steroids, volatile oils, alkaloids, proteins, quinine derivatives, tannins, and saponins. The presence of these phytochemicals supports the use of Leea species in traditional medicine. Further studies are necessary to isolate these compounds and understand their mechanism of action.
